878 /* Try to respect any style tags present in the subtitle string. The main
879 * problem here is a lack of adequate specs for the subtitle formats.
880 * SSA/ASS and USF are both detail spec'ed -- but they are handled elsewhere.
881 * SAMI has a detailed spec, but extensive rework is needed in the demux
882 * code to prevent all this style information being excised, as it presently
884 * That leaves the others - none of which were (I guess) originally intended
885 * to be carrying style information. Over time people have used them that way.
886 * In the absence of specifications from which to work, the tags supported
887 * have been restricted to the simple set permitted by the USF DTD, ie. :
888 * Basic: <br>, <i>, <b>, <u>
900 * There is also the further restriction that the subtitle be well-formed
901 * as an XML entity, ie. the HTML sentence:
902 * <b><i>Bold and Italics</b></i>
903 * doesn't qualify because the tags aren't nested one inside the other.
904 * <text> tags are automatically added to the output to ensure
906 * If the text doesn't qualify for any reason, a NULL string is
907 * returned, and the rendering engine will fall back to the
908 * plain text version of the subtitle.
